At 1.6 miles from Port Sa Ràpita. This beach is the last big sandy area in Majorca, that remains undeveloped  and wellpreserved. With Es Salobrar de Camposit forms a protected area of 1,492 hectares. One of the most popular virgin spaces during the summer.
Es Trenc offers fine white sand, a gentle slope, a system of dunes and fully transparent waters. Nudity is permitted. Its length is 1900 meters, its width 22 meters. We can find several bars and restaurants along the beach.

Anchoring: Open from south to west, the bottom is sand, algae and some small areas of stones. Drop anchor at a depth of four meters.

It is important to anchor away from the beach, because there are slabs near the beach. We should also pay attention to the currents and use a long anchor chain.
